GM from Rolling Period
Estimate effective GM from an observed natural rolling period using the Weiss/IMO formula - no inclining test required.

Formula, assumptions, and limits
$$GM = \frac{4 \pi^2 (C \cdot B)^2}{g \cdot T^2}$$
Time an unforced full roll cycle (port-starboard-port = one period) at least five times and average. Accurate ±10 % for small heels. Not a substitute for the inclining experiment in the lightship condition.
Symbol legend
| Symbol | Meaning | Unit | Source |
|---|---|---|---|
| $B$ | Ship beam at waterline | m | ship particulars |
| $T$ | Natural rolling period | s | timed observation |
| $C$ | Empirical roll factor (≈0.373) | - | IMO Res A.749(18) |
| $g$ | Gravitational acceleration | m/s² | 9.81 |
| $GM$ | Metacentric height | m | result |
